Up the Downstairs played the Baggot Inn in Dublin as part of a three band Limerick showcase in August 1989, along with They Do It with Mirrors and Private World.
Reindeer Age
The Reindeer Age album, was recorded at the Xeric Studio in Limerick in 1989. This compilation album featured fellow Limerick Bands, The Hitchers, The O’Malley’s A Touch Of Oliver, Up The Downstairs, Tuesday Blue, They Do It With Mirrors, Private World, The Drive, The Separators, Toucandance, Perfect Moment, Utopian Puppets, The Surrealists, X-It, Big John’s Bootleggin Band. The cassette version featured two extra tracks by Preachers Story & Mike O’Mahony.
